The Camp Airy & Camp Louise Foundation Inc.

Fiscal year ending 2022. Filed on August 24, 2023.

5750 Park Heights Ave Suite 306
Baltimore, Maryland 21215

The Camp Airy & Camp Louise Foundation Inc. (EIN: 52-0563083) has filed an IRS Form 990 since at least fiscal year 2016. In its fiscal year 2022 IRS Form 990 filing, The Camp Airy & Camp Louise Foundation Inc., a 501(c)(3) charitable organization, reported compensation for 4 out of 493 total employees. Among the employees shown here, the average compensation is $182,214. The highest compensated employee at The Camp Airy & Camp Louise Foundation Inc. is Jonathan Gerstl with fiscal year 2022 compensation of $353,201.

Mission Statement

THE MISSION OF CAMPS AIRY AND LOUISE IS TO BE THE LEADING PROVIDER OF AN EXCEPTIONAL, FUN-FILLED OVERNIGHT CAMP EXPERIENCE FOR JEWISH YOUTH BY CREATING A COMMUNITY THAT INSPIRES INDIVIDUALITY, ENHANCES SKILLS, INTRODUCES NEW EXPERIENCES, ENCOURAGES SOCIAL RESPONSIBILITY AND BUILDS LIFELONG FRIENDSHIPS.
